Spinach Omelette Recipe
Preparation Time: 10 minutes
Cooking Time: 15 minutes
Total Time: 25 minutes
Servings: 3
Cuisine: Continental
Course: World Breakfast
Diet: Eggetarian
Ingredients
Ingredient | Quantity |
---|---|
Whole Eggs | 4 |
Spinach (fresh bunch) | 1 bunch |
Spring Onion Greens (finely chopped) | 6 |
Turmeric Powder (Haldi) | 1/2 teaspoon |
Red Chilli Powder | 2 teaspoons |
Salt | 1/2 teaspoon |
Milk | 4 tablespoons |
Extra Virgin Olive Oil | 2 tablespoons |
Instructions
-
Prepare the Spinach
Start by thoroughly washing the spinach leaves and chopping them into small pieces. Place the chopped spinach in a microwave-safe bowl and microwave for about 1 minute. The goal is not to cook it fully, but just to soften it slightly and remove the rawness without making it soggy. -
Prepare the Eggs
Break the eggs one by one into a mixing bowl. Use a fork to beat them well until they become light and fluffy, which helps create a soft, airy texture in the omelette. -
Add Spices and Vegetables
To the beaten eggs, add the turmeric powder and red chilli powder. Whisk again to combine these spices evenly into the eggs. Next, stir in the chopped spring onion greens and the microwaved spinach, ensuring they are well distributed throughout the mixture. -
Add Milk and Salt
Pour in the milk and add the salt, whisking the mixture lightly until everything is well incorporated. The milk adds a touch of creaminess and helps achieve a tender omelette. -
Cook the Omelette
Heat a non-stick pan over medium heat and add the olive oil, spreading it evenly across the surface of the pan. Once the oil is hot, pour the egg mixture into the pan. Swirl the pan gently to ensure the mixture spreads evenly across the surface. -
Cook the Omelette on One Side
Allow the omelette to cook covered with a lid for about 7-10 minutes. During this time, the eggs will firm up, and the spinach and spring onions will cook through. Keep an eye on it to avoid burning. -
Flip the Omelette
After 7-10 minutes, the bottom of the omelette should be golden and firm. Carefully flip the omelette using a spatula, and cook for another 4-5 minutes on the other side, until fully cooked through and firm. -
Finishing Touches
Once both sides of the omelette are golden and firm, remove the pan from heat and let the omelette rest in the pan for about a minute. This allows it to settle and maintain its shape. -
Serve
Slide the spinach omelette onto a plate and serve immediately with toasted bread. For a wholesome, nutritious breakfast, pair it with a refreshing Chickoo Banana Date Smoothie.
